NNPC and Total Upstream Nigeria Limited (TUPNI), in pursuance of its Corporate Social Responsibility, invites applications from suitably qualified and interested Nigerians for the 2017/2018 National Merit Scholarship of NNPC/TOTAL SCHOLARSHIP which is on now.

The NNPC/Total 2017/2018 Undergraduate Scholarship Scheme application is on and the portal is now open to receive applications from eligible and interested Nigerian undergraduates.

Eligibility

Applicant MUST:

  • Be a Registered FULL TIME undergraduate in a recognized Nigerian University
  • A 100 or 200 level student at the time of application
  • Have CGPA above 2.50

Requirements for the scholarship

  • Recent Passport Photograph
  • SSCE result or Equivalent Certificate.
  • Unified Tertiary Matriculation Examinations (UTME) score.
  • Proof of Admission letter from the University (JAMB Admission letter)
  • University Matriculation Number
  • A-level or Equivalent Certificate (for direct entry students)
  • LGA Certificate or Proof of Origin
  • UTME result
  • 1st Year Result showing CGPA

Closing Date

All Applications are to be completed and submitted on or before October 31, 2017.

Examination date

Selection tests will hold on December 2, 2017 at designated centers nationwide which will be communicated to all shortlisted candidates only.  So you are advised to choose a nearby exam centre during the online registration.

Important notice to all applicants

  • Any candidate with less than 200 score in UTME should not to apply.
  • Any student with less than 2.50 CGPA of 5-point scale, or equivalent should not apply.
  • A 300 level students and above should not to apply.
  • Any current beneficiaries of similar awards or NNPC/Total Scholarship from the oil industry should not to apply.
  • All Candidates will fully bear the cost transportation to and fro test venue as no reimbursement will be made.
